Crash of a Short S.29 Stirling I in Warnemünde: 8 killed
Date & Time:
Dec 8, 1942 at 1950 LT
Registration:
R9253
Survivors:
No
Schedule:
Lakenheath - Lakenheath
Crew on board:
8
Crew fatalities:
Pax on board:
0
Pax fatalities:
Other fatalities:
Total fatalities:
8
Circumstances:
The airplane departed RAF Lakenheath at 1635LT to lay mines off Warnemünde. Approaching the target area, it was shot down by the German Flak and crashed, killing the entire crew.
Crew:
F/O Laurence Theodore Izzard, pilot,
Sgt Daniel Patrick McAleese, flight engineer,
Sgt Philip Wedgwood Ditchburn,
F/Sgt Stephen Holroyd Hopkinson,
Sgt John Lind Strachan,
Sgt Fraser Hutchinson Watt,
Sgt Robert Henry Williams,
Sgt William Osborn, air gunner.
